Please keep in mind that even though these monitors were calibrated using a colorimeter/photometer the profiles may or may not work correctly with your monitor.
In order to find your monitor profile you go here:
XP
C:\WINDOWS\System32\Spool\Drivers\Color
Win2K
C:\WINNT\System32\Spool\Drivers\Color
Mac OS X
/Library/Colorsync/Profiles (System wide)
~/Library/Colorsync/Profiles (User folder)

NEC
Profile name: 20WMGX2 Calibrated.icc
Make/Model/Size: NEC 20WMGX2 20"
Calibration system: ColorEyes Display 3.2 software with Eye-One Display 2 colorimeter
Brightness: 25% (can be set higher without significantly affecting colors)
Contrast: 50%
Sharpness: 8.3%
Advanced DV mode: OFF
DV mode: Text
Red: 100.0%
Green: 95.2%
Blue: 96.8%
